Wifi: Add 6GHz band to NAN structures and methods

This commit adds 6GHz band to NAN related structures and methods.

Bug: 139354972
Test: Manual
Test: VTS test
Test: Unit test:
Test: ./hardware/interfaces/wifi/1.4/default/tests/runtests.sh
Change-Id: I33f63fde67d5a839678076fdb7c76d5eb8645131
